Steven Warren, President and Founder of D.R.E.A.M. is a graduate and former college student-athlete from the University of Nebraska-Lincoln with a degree in Sociology. After leaving Nebraska, Steven went on to play several years for the NFL’s Green Bay Packers, and the AFL’s San Jose Sabercats and Arizona Rattlers.  Through his experience as a college and professional athlete, Steven came to realize young boys and girls are easily influenced by their “champions,” especially those in professional sports and entertainment, so he decided to give back using his experiences as motivation for others.

“Every day I wake up and thank God for showing me the path to have founded D.R.E.A.M. What a great feeling to be able to help impact someone’s life in a positive way and help bring change. Our hope is to see the youth we work with graduate, further their education, give back and become productive members in the community.”

-Steven Warren, President & Founder
